Take a step back, refocus, and Reset with Lynlee. Airing weekdays from 1pm to 4pm, the show brings clarity to the stories shaping Singapore and the world — from current affairs and global developments to business trends and industry shifts. Through insightful conversations and fresh perspectives, Lynlee explores what’s driving the headlines and where things are heading next. Featuring segments like Viewpoint, Industry Insight and Suite Talk, Reset goes beyond the noise to offer thoughtful analysis, real-world context and ideas that help you recalibrate for the rest of your day.

22/07/26 - Industry Insight: Why Singapore is attracting more global capitalSingapore has emerged as one of this year's standout investment destinations, attracting growing interest from global investors. But beyond the headlines, what's fueling this momentum? And are the qualities investors look for in a market beginning to change?
On Industry Insight, Lynlee Foo speaks to Kunhee Park, ETF Equities Investment Strategist at State Street Investment Management, about why capital is flowing into Singapore, what investors are prioritising today, and what this says about the evolving global investment landscape.

21/07/26 - Industry Insight: The AI bot arms raceBots are no longer just buying up concert tickets.
Powered by AI, they're becoming faster, harder to detect and capable of launching sophisticated attacks at unprecedented speed. As organisations race to keep up, cybersecurity is evolving beyond protecting systems to establishing trust in every digital interaction.
What does this mean for businesses, consumers and the future of online security? On Industry Insight, Lynlee Foo speaks with Daniel Toh, Chief Solution Architect, APJ at Thales, a global technology company with businesses spanning aerospace, defence, cybersecurity and digital identity.

20/07/26 - Viewpoint: Why China wants the world to build on its AIThe AI race is no longer just about who builds the smartest models. It may increasingly be about who gets the world to use them.
China is pushing to expand the global reach of its AI models, but what is it really trying to achieve? Lynlee Foo speaks with Gary Ng, Hong Kong-based Senior Economist for Asia Pacific at global financial group Natixis, about why AI has become an economic and geopolitical strategy, how China's approach differs from that of the US, and what it could mean for Singapore and businesses navigating two emerging AI ecosystems.

14/07/26 - Industry Insight: How much is supply chain resilience worth?Businesses have long focused on making supply chains faster, leaner and cheaper. But after years of global disruption, many are now willing to pay more to make sure they can keep operating when the unexpected happens.
Lynlee Foo speaks with Chris Hampden, Senior Vice President at Proxima, the global procurement and supply chain consultancy that is part of Bain & Company, about why supply chain resilience has become a boardroom priority, how companies are balancing cost against risk, whether consumers will eventually pay the price, and why AI is both strengthening and complicating global supply chains.
